I have worked as a pharmacy technician at Gundersen Health System for the past 9 years. Over that time, I have staffed in a variety of capacities and held several roles within the Inpatient Pharmacy. As a staffing technician, I delivered meds, rounded floors, restocked ADS machines, compounded IV meds, was a member of the USP 797/800 cleaning team for the facility. I filled support roles for several years in the pharmacy providing controlled substance diversion monitoring and investigation support and operating as the billing and coding liaison within pharmacy. I also served as the 340B Coordinator for Gundersen Health System before taking my current role as an Application Analyst in Pharmacy Information Systems. in my free time, I love to spend time outdoors.
